The size of Warriewood is approximately 4.2 square kilometres. It has 16 parks covering nearly 27.6% of total area. The population of Warriewood in 2016 was 7501 people. By 2021 the population was 8379 showing a population growth of 11.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Warriewood is 40-49 years. Households in Warriewood are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Warriewood work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 77.90% of the homes in Warriewood were owner-occupied compared with 76.30% in 2016.
